Deputy President Kithure Kindiki, accompanied by a host of other leaders, visited the home of Farouk Kibet in Uasin Gishu County on Saturday. The visit, which drew significant political attention, highlighted the strong alliances and relationships within the country’s political landscape.
Farouk Kibet, a close ally of President William Ruto, is known for his influence in the political corridors of power. His home in Sugoi has often been a focal point for high-level political engagements, further cementing his role as a key strategist in the Kenya Kwanza administration.
During the visit, Deputy President Kindiki was joined by several governors, Members of Parliament, and county leaders. Among the prominent figures present were Uasin Gishu Governor Jonathan Bii, National Assembly Majority Leader Kimani Ichung’wah, and a number of senators and MPs from the Rift Valley region.
Speaking during the visit, Deputy President Kindiki emphasized the importance of unity among leaders in delivering on the Kenya Kwanza administration’s development agenda. He reiterated the government’s commitment to uplifting the lives of Kenyans, particularly in agriculture-rich counties like Uasin Gishu.
“This region remains a cornerstone of Kenya’s agricultural economy, and we are committed to ensuring that farmers get the support they need to thrive. Through unity and collaboration, we can achieve transformative progress for our people,” Kindiki said.
Farouk Kibet thanked the leaders for their visit and pledged continued support for the government’s initiatives. He highlighted the need for grassroots engagement in shaping policies that address the needs of ordinary citizens.
The meeting comes at a time when the Kenya Kwanza administration is focusing on consolidating its base in the Rift Valley region. Political analysts view the gathering as a strategic move to strengthen alliances and reinforce the government’s agenda ahead of future elections.
The visit also offered a platform for leaders to discuss pressing issues affecting the region, including the ongoing drought, food security, and infrastructure development.
The leaders later shared a meal, underscoring the camaraderie and unity that characterized the event. The gathering reaffirmed the pivotal role of Uasin Gishu County in the national political arena.
